A garden may look quiet. But underneath the soil, inside the leaves, and between the flowers, something is always happening.

A seed cracks open. A tiny root pushes down into the soil. A stem reaches toward the light. Bees visit flowers. Fruits begin to grow. And eventually, new seeds are ready to start the whole story again.
